Differential Diagnosis of Metastatic Bone Disease and Benign Bone Disease on Spine SPECT in Patients with Low Back Pain (요통 환자의 척추골 SPECT에서 골전이 병변과 양성골질환의 섭취 양상 분석을 통한 감별진단이 가능한가)

  • Lee, Seung-Hun;Choi, Yun-Young;Cho, Suk-Shin
    • The Korean Journal of Nuclear Medicine
    • /
    • v.35 no.6
    • /
    • pp.371-377
    • /
    • 2001
  • Purpose: One or more abnormal vertebrae detected on bone scintigraphy is a common finding in clinical practice, and it could pose a diagnostic dilemma especially in cancer patients. as either metastasis or benign disease may cause scintigraphic abnormality. The purpose of this study was to determine whether additional spine SPECT has a role in differentiating malignant from benign lesions in patients with back pain. Materials and Methods: We reviewed spine SPECT studios obtained over a three-year period in 108 patients. Among them, forty-five patients with abnormal SPECT and clinically followed records were evaluated (20 cancer patients were included). Uptake patterns were classified as follows: 1. Body: diffusely increased uptake, linear increased uptake of end plate, segmental increased uptake, and cold defect, 2. Posterior element: posterior to body (pedicle), posterior to Intervertebral disc space (facet joint), and spinous process. Lesions were correlated with radiological findings and with final diagnosis. Results: Sixty-nine bone lesions were detected on SFECT images, including 18 metastases, 28 degenerative diseases and 21 compression fractures. Cold defect (6) and segmental increased uptake (5) were dominant findings in metastasis; linear increased uptake (12), and facet joint uptake (15) were in degenerative change; and diffuse increased uptake (9), and linear increased uptake (9) were in compression fracture. Conclusion: Cold defect and segmental increased uptake of body were characteristic findings of metastasis, but care should be taken because compression fracture also shows segmental increased uptake in some cases. Degenerative disease was easily diagnosed because of the typical finding of linear increased uptake of end plate and facet joint. Therefore, additional bone SPECT after planar bone scan would be helpful for differentiating metastasis from benign condition in cancer patients.

Prevalence of Incidentally Detected Spondylolysis in Children (소아 환자에서 우연히 발견되는 척추분리증의 유병률)

  • Boram Song;Sun Kyoung You;Jeong Eun Lee;So Mi Lee;Hyun-Hae Cho
    • Journal of the Korean Society of Radiology
    • /
    • v.83 no.1
    • /
    • pp.127-137
    • /
    • 2022
  • Purpose To assess the prevalence of incidentally detected lumbar spondylolysis in children. Materials and Methods We retrospectively reviewed the data of 809 patients under the age of 11 years (mean age, 7.0 ± 2.7 years; boys:girls = 479:330) who underwent abdominal and pelvic CT between March 2014 and December 2018. We recorded the presence, level, and laterality (unilateral or bilateral) of spondylolysis. Patients were divided into two groups based on the presence of spondylolysis: the spondylolysis (SP) and non-SP groups. Results In total, 21 cases of spondylolysis were detected in 20 patients (20/809, 2.5%). The mean age of the SP group was higher than that of the non-SP group (7.8 ± 1.8 vs. 6.9 ± 2.7 years, p > 0.05). The prevalence of spondylolysis in boys was higher than that in girls (15/479 [3.1%] vs. 5/330 [1.5%], p > 0.05). The prevalence of spondylolysis in school-age children (6-10 year olds) was higher than that in preschool-age children (0-5 year olds) (17/538 [3.2%] vs. 3/271 [1.1%], p > 0.05). L5 was the most common level of spondylolysis (76.2%); one 8-year-old boy had two-level spondylolysis. One case of isthmic spondylolisthesis was detected in a 10-year-old boy (1/809, 0.1%). There were 11 unilateral spondylolysis cases (11/21, 52.4%). Conclusion In our study, the prevalence of spondylolysis in children under the age of 11 was 2.5%. The prevalence was higher in boys than in girls and in school-age than in preschool-age children, despite the lack of any statistically significant differences.

Characteristic of Cross-sectional Area of Lumbar Paraspinal Muscle in Patients of Acute and Chronic LBP (20대와 40대의 급성 및 만성요통환자의 척추주위 근육에 관한 횡단면의 비교)

  • Kim, Dae-Hun;Park, Jin-Kyu;Park, Yun-Jin;Jung, Dae-In;Kim, Seong-Su
    • The Journal of the Korea Contents Association
    • /
    • v.11 no.6
    • /
    • pp.270-278
    • /
    • 2011
  • The purpose of this study was to compare acute and chronic LBP patient in twenties and forties, respectively by size measure paraspinal muscle (cross-sectional area; CSA). CSA of paraspinal muscle (psoas, multifidus, erector muscle) size was measured by free-handling technique of the picture archiving and communication system(PACS) using MRI at the level(lower end-plate of L4) in twenties(9 males, 10 females) and forties(9 males, 8 females) in acute and chronic LBP patient. The results of this study showed no significantly difference between acute and chronic LBP (p>0.05) in twenties patients. However, there was significant difference between acute and chronic LBP (p<0.05) in forties patients. Also, there was significant difference in paraspinal muscle CSA between chronic LBP patients in twenties and chronic LBP patients in forties (p<0.05). This study showed that paraspinal muscle atrophy was observed in forties with various cause, but Not chronic LBP patients in twenties. Accordingly it is required for chronic LBP patients in forties to minimize trunk muscle atrophy through immediate back muscle dynamic exercise and early functional activity.

Primary Spinal Epidural Lymphoma Mimicking Epidural Abscess in a Diabetic - A Case Report - (당뇨 환자에서 경막외 농양과의 감별을 요한 원발성 척추 경막외 임파종 - 증례보고 -)

  • Kim, Se Hoon;Lim, Dong Jun;Cho, Tai Hyoung;Chung, Yong Gu;Lee, Hoon Kap;Lee, Ki Chan;Suh, Jung Keun
    • Journal of Korean Neurosurgical Society
    • /
    • v.30 no.3
    • /
    • pp.395-399
    • /
    • 2001
  • Primary spinal epidural lymphoma(SEL), i.e. occurring in the absence of any detectable extraspinal lymphoproliferative disorder, is an unusual cause of spinal cord compression. The authors report a 48-year-old, diabetic woman presented with back pain followed by acute paraparesis and voiding difficulty. She had been treated with acupunctures on her back before admission, and complete blood count showed leukocytosis with neutrophilia and increased erythrocyte sedimentation rate(ESR). Thoracic spine magnetic resonance imaging(MRI) revealed an epidural mass extending from T5 to T8 with compression of the spinal cord. Emergency decompressive laminectomy was performed with a tentative diagnosis of spinal epidural abscess, but a B-cell lymphoma was final pathologic diagnosis. Further staging showed no other sites of lymphoma, and the spinal lesion was treated by chemotherapy and radiotherapy. The authors stress that primary SEL can mimic spinal epidural abscess(SEA) in the diabetic patient and should be a diagnostic consideration in patients with a syndrome of acute spinal cord compression manifested by a prodrome of back pain and neuroimaging consistent with an epidural compressive lesion, especially in a diabetic.

The Measurement of Size of the Pedicle Using 3 Dimensional Reconstruction Image in Idiopathic Scoliosis (특발성 척추측만증 환자에서의 3차원적 재구성을 이용한 척추경의 크기 측정)

  • Heo, Jae-Hee;Ahn, Myun-Hwan
    • Journal of Yeungnam Medical Science
    • /
    • v.21 no.1
    • /
    • pp.40-50
    • /
    • 2004
  • Background: This study was conducted to analyze the height and width of the pedicle of the upper and lower levels on the concave and the convex sides. In addition, we checked for the appropriate pedicle screw size which could be screwed in without complications. Materials and Methods: Taking a simple AP radiography in a standing position, 99 vertebrae on the major curve with the possibility of 3-D reconstruction were analyzed after checking the CT in a supine position of 22 idiopathic scoliosis. We measured Cobb's angle from a simple radiograph, and measured the size of the isthmus by the Inner Space 3-D Editor after 3-D reconstruction with the Inner Space 3-D program in the DICOM file transformed from CT image. We then analyzed the size of pedicles of the upper and lower levels on the concave and the convex sides by measuring the height and width of the pedicle. Results: All pedicles on the concave side were smaller than those on the convex side. Their size increased as the measurement moved from the upper to lower vertebra, except for the upper thoracic vertebra. When the width of the pedicle through 3-D reconstruction was compared with the narrowest width of the pedicle measured by using CT, the width of the pedicles through 3-D reconstruction was statistically smaller (P<0.01). Most of the pedicles were tear-drop or kidney shaped rather than cylindrical. Conclusion: These results suggest that the use of the coronal plane through 3-D reconstruction would be necessary for an accurate measurement of the size of the pedicle. It is important to pay careful attention to the screw size and the screwing method considering the pedicle shape through 3-D reconstruction.

A Micro Finite Element Analysis on Effects of Altering Monomer-to-Powder ]Ratio of Bone Cement During Vertebroplasty (골 시멘트 중합 비율 변경이 척추성형술 치료에 미치는 영향에 대한 비교 분석)

  • 김형도;탁계래;김한성
    • Journal of Biomedical Engineering Research
    • /
    • v.23 no.6
    • /
    • pp.451-458
    • /
    • 2002
  • Osteoporosis is a systemic skeletal disease caused by low bone mass and the decrease of bone density in the microstructure of trabecular bone. Drug therapy(PTH Parathyroid hormone) may increase the trabecular thickness and thus bone strength. Vertebroplasty is a minimally invasive surgery foy the treatment of osteoporotic vertebral compression fracture. This Procedure includes Puncturing vertebrae and filling with Polymethylmethacrylate(PMMA). Although altering recommended monomer-to-Powder ratio affects material properties of bone cement, clinicians commonly alter the mixture ratio to decrease viscosity and increase the working time. The Purposes of this study were to analyze the effect of 4he monomer-to-powder ratio on the mechanical characteristics of trabecular. In this paper, the finite element model of human vertebral trabecualr bone was developed by modified Voronoi diagram, to analyze the relative effect of hormone therapy and vertebroplasty at the treatment of osteoporotic vertebrae. Trabeuclar bone models for vertebroplasty with varied monomer-to-Powder ratio(0.40∼1.07 ㎖/g) were analyzed. Effective modulus and strength of bone cement-treated models were approximately 60% of those of intact models and these are almost twice the values of hormone-treated models. The bone cement models with the ratio of 0.53㎖/g have the maximum modulus and strength. For the ratio of 1.07㎖/g, the modulus and strength were minimum(42% and 49% respectively) but these were greater than those for drug therapy. This study shows that bone cement treatment is more effective than drug therapy. It is found that in vertebroplasty, using a monomer-to-powder ratio different from that recommended by manufacturer nay significantly not only reduce the cement's material Properties but also deteriorate the mechanical characteristics of osteoporotic vertebrae.

A Qualitative Analysis on Paraspinal Muscles in Patients with Acute Low Back Pain and Chronic Low Back Pain (급성 요통환자와 만성 요통환자에서 척추주변근육의 정량적 분석)

  • Jeong, Dae-Keun
    • Journal of Digital Convergence
    • /
    • v.11 no.11
    • /
    • pp.613-620
    • /
    • 2013
  • This study was conducted to measure and analyze the changes in paraspinal muscles of acute and chronic low back pain patients using MRI, and to provide clinical basic data for diagnosis and treatment for low back pain. For this purpose, 20 patients with acute low back pain frome August 2012 to January 2013 which occurred within 12 weeks, and 20 patients with chronic low back pain that progressed over 12 weeks, were chosen as subjects, and their MRI measurements were compared with one another. As a result, in relation to in the fatty degeneration ratio of the left spine and right spine, there were significant differences in erector spinae and multifidus(p<.001), and in relation to the Fat Infiltration ratio between all the groups, there were significant differences in psoas major, erector spinae and multifidus between the acute low back pain patient group and the chronic low back pain patient group(p<.001). In the post-hoc test, multifidus and erector spinae in the acute low back pain group and chronic low back pain group showed the highest Fat Infiltration ratio. The serious Fat Infiltration of multifidus and erector spinae in the chronic low back pain group led to weakened strength of muscles that stabilize the spine. In conclusion, it is considered that this study would present important data and basis in making acute and chronic low back pain patients pay more attention to multifidus and psoas major during rehabilitation exercise, and selecting a rehabilitation exercise program.

Relationship between Environmental Factors and Macrobenthos Assemblages in Geum Estuary Tidal-flat (금강하구 갯벌 내 환경요인과 저서성무척추동물 군집 분포의 상관관계)

  • Yoo, Jae-Won;Lee, Chae-Lin;Park, Mi-Ra;Yoon, Jihyun;Kang, Sung-Ryong
    • Journal of Wetlands Research
    • /
    • v.21 no.1
    • /
    • pp.84-94
    • /
    • 2019
  • The Seocheon and Yubu Island mudflats in Geum Estuary are important stopover sites for migratory birds as energy supplementation area in the East Asia-Australasian Flyway. Benthic invertebrates in the tidal flats are important food resources for the migratory birds. In other words, benthic invertebrates in the tidal flats play an important ecological role in energy flow. This study was conducted to investigate the relationship between benthic invertebrate assemblages and environmental factors in Seocheon and Yubudo tidal flats in the Geum Estuary. As a result of the benthic invertebrate assemblage during the fall migration season, the total species number was 147, density and biomass were $1,772{\pm}1,342individuals/m^2$ and $445.1{\pm}807.6g/m^2$, respectively. Based on the appearance species and the density data, the result of analysis of mutual similarity among sampling sites was divided into two groups. Group A was the Macrophthalmus-Heteromastus community and Group B was the Spio-Urothoe-Mandibulophoxus community. Group B showed higher mean species number, density and biomass than Group A. The BIO-ENV analysis showed that the benthic invertebrate assemblages were most affected by the combination of sand content % and sediment sorting (${\rho}=0.500$). The variables of significant relationship with species number and biomass were sediment sorting (p=0.015) and the pore water DO(Dissolved Oxygen, p=0.003) in sediment, respectively.
